NBA's 2021 All-Star Game in Indianapolis is postponed for three years as Indiana experiences its deadliest month of the pandemic with 1,055 deaths and a surge in cases

Indianapolis will host the NBA All-Star weekend in 2024, the league said Wednesday, formally rescheduling the plans for that city to be the site of the league's mid-season showcase this season.

Cleveland will play host in 2022 and Salt Lake City will do so in 2023 - both of those sites and years previously announced. The next open spot on the league's All-Star calendar was 2024, which now belongs to Indianapolis.

The league said 'public health conditions prevented the Pacers, the NBA All-Star Host Committee and the NBA from appropriately planning and executing fan-focused All-Star activities in Indianapolis that were envisioned for this February.'

The new dates for Indianapolis' All-Star weekend: February 16-18, 2024.

'While we are disappointed that the NBA All-Star Game will not take place in Indianapolis in 2021, we are looking forward to the Pacers and the city hosting the game and surrounding events in 2024,' NBA Commissioner Adam Silver said.

The news had been expected for months. The league released hotel blocks for what would have been the 2021 All-Star weekend back in August and is in the process of finalizing a schedule for this season - which begins December 22.

The league said it is planning to revise this season's All-Star agenda, with those plans still to be announced.

Like most states, Indiana is facing a major surge in COVID-19 cases.

All but one of Indiana's counties are listed in the moderate and highest-risk categories of coronavirus spread as Wednesday's update from state health officials showed a 91 percent increase in COVID-19 hospitalizations since the beginning of November.

The Indiana State Department of Health also added 63 more deaths to Indiana's pandemic toll, making November Indiana's deadliest COVID-19 month with 1,055 confirmed deaths. The previous monthly high for coronavirus deaths was 1,041 in April, when at most the state's moving seven-day average was 42 fatalities a day.

The additional deaths raised Indiana's pandemic total to 5,498 COVID-19 fatalities, including confirmed and presumed coronavirus infections, since March.

For the second consecutive week, the state health department listed 91 of the state's 92 counties in the highest two of its four risk levels in its weekly tracking map update released Wednesday. The agency assigned the most dangerous red rating to 17 counties scattered around the state. Only one county was listed in the less-serious yellow rating, while none received the lowest-level blue rating.

Republican Gov. Eric Holcomb, who was scheduled to take part in a Wednesday afternoon briefing on the state's coronavirus response, lifted most restrictions on businesses and crowds in late September.

In that time, Indiana's rates of new COVID-19 infections, hospitalizations and deaths began a steep increase. Hospitalizations have jumped 312 percent to a pandemic high of 3,363 patients as of Tuesday, and its seven-day rolling average COVID-19 deaths has jumped from 10 a day to 49.
